Abstract
A fuel supply pump with a large fuel discharge amount and a tappet structure body, which are suitably used for an accumulated pressure-type fuel injection device that mechanically amplifies pressure, is provided. A fuel supply pump has a tappet structural body and a spring sheet, wherein a penetration portion for allowing passage of a lubricant or a fuel for lubrication therethrough by coordinating the tappet structure and the spring sheet is provided between a spring-holding chamber for holding a spring to be used for pulling up a plunger and a cam chamber for housing a cam to be used for moving the plunger up and down.
